## Break-Glass: Shrinkray CLI

Shrinkray is our batch image-resizing CLI used by the Pixelbarn support team. If the normal job queue is down and a customer batch is stuck, you can run Shrinkray directly on the fallback node — but that's break-glass territory, so it gets logged and reviewed. To unlock the fallback node, use the passphrase below.

vault phrase of bagaf-kajeg = jorath-feniel-briir-siliel-ralix

# Approvals: Tile-Rendering Cache Layer

The Cartavia tile cache sits between the render farm and the CDN, keyed on zoom, coordinates, and style hash. Changes to eviction policy or key schema require approval before merge. Reviewers should check that invalidation hooks fire on style updates and that hit-rate dashboards are updated. Standard performance changes need one approval. Schema changes must be signed off by the owner listed below.

signatory, tajep-yajep: Gorael Fraael Sorius Ralax

## Changelog — Ticktrace 1.9

### Renamed: DRIFT_API_TOKEN
During the cron drift investigation we found plugins confusing this variable with the metrics token, so it has been renamed to indicate it authorizes drift-report uploads specifically. Plugin authors must read the new name from 1.9 onward; the old name is ignored without warning. Sample env files in the SDK are updated. In your deployment env file, the drift-report upload secret is set on the next line.

env line for fawef-taguf: VAULT_KEY13=a9695905a9a90

Runbook — Fixing the N+1 mess in Quillgraph

So the `orders -> lineItems` resolver was firing one query per row again after the Lanternfall deploy. Classic N+1. The fix is already merged: we batch through the loader layer now, so if you see DB connection spikes, first check that batching didn't get toggled off. Don't hand-patch resolvers at 3am — just roll back and page Tovi's team in the morning. The loader and batching settings currently in production are shown below.

config for tagep-yajef:
ulawyn:
  log_level: error
  metrics_host: metrics.ulawyn.lumiclabs.internal
  pin: 0564
  pool_size: 32